The first thing we do in a child support case is to seek information. To calculate the default numbers for child support, we'll need to know your income, and the income of the non-custodial parent. Sometimes non-custodial parents will try to hide their income to decrease child support payments, and we know how to find out how much money someone really makes. We also know what factors to plead if the default child support number is too low, and should be higher in your specific case.

Remember, the more information you can give us, the more help we can be for you, and the more likely we are to be able to get someone to pay. Even minor details can make a difference. For example, does the other parent fish? Fishing licenses can be suspended for non-payment of child support, which can be a great way for you to get paid.
